点击enter的时候进行搜索, 1、如何获取用户输入的关键字呢? image.png 看下是用户目前输入的值,但是value绑定的是用户从下拉框里选取的值 所以如何获取呢? 其实我们可以从filter-method/remote-method中获取,这俩方法都可以他的形参就是这个输入值。 想到这是不是已经很明了了呢,有关键字,也能监听到enter事件,el...
remote //表示远程搜索 :remote-method="remoteMethod" //远程搜索方法 > 方法部分,添加remoteMethod方法: remoteMethod(query) { if (query !== '') { setTimeout(() => { this.dataItems = this.allData.filter(item => { return item.value.toLowerCase() //这里同样是匹配选项的value .indexOf(qu...
要实现远程搜索功能,你需要设置el-select组件的remote、filterable、reserve-keyword属性,并绑定remote-method方法。这个方法会在用户输入时调用,用于发送远程搜索请求。 设置el-select属性: html <el-select v-model="selectedValue" filterable remote reserve-keyword placeholder="请输入搜索内容" :remote-method="re...
产品要求是按tab键 跳进表单项 输入数据后 按tab键 选择当前输入的值并跳进下一个表单项 用remote-method获取到搜索出的列表,select循环中的列表搜索出来的列表,然后tab键选择出搜索列表的第一个,然后再加上个点击input框时候,获取未搜索时的列表数据 remoteMethod(query,list) { if (query !=='') { this....
理论上我也可以在filter-method里去实现远程搜索,那么remote-method和filter-method有什么区别呢? 👍 1 Member element-bot commented Jul 30, 2020 Translation of this issue: Existing Component yes Component Name el-select Description Theoretically, I can also implement remote search in filter method. ...
<el-select v-if="isShowCompanyOpts" :disabled="props.isView" v-model="ruleFiltersDto.orgId" filterable remote placeho
remoteMethod(query,list) { if (query !=='') { this.loading =true; let arr = []setTimeout(() => { this.loading =false; arr = list.filter(item => { return item.code.toLowerCase().indexOf(query.toLowerCase()) > -1...
element-ui的select有一个fildter-method方法,我们可以通过这个方法来进行过滤下拉项 假设我们有个下拉框是用来选择用户的 <el-selectv-model="userId"filterable :filter-method="userFilter"clearable> <el-optionv-for="item in userList":key="item.userId":label="item.username":value="item.userId"></...
在本文中,我们深入探讨了el-select提供的props用法,包括filterable、filter-method、multiple、collapse-tags、multiple-limit、remote和remote-method等属性。通过灵活地运用这些props,我们可以实现更加符合实际需求的下拉选择功能,帮助用户更加便捷地进行选项选择。我们还提到了一些需要注意的细节和问题,以帮助开发者更好地理解...
修改select组件属性: filter-method ---> 自定义搜索方法 使用:filter-method="this._.debounce(this.remoteMethod, 1000, false)"//搜索内容的时候进行防抖代替 remote//是否为远程搜索:remote-method="remoteMethod"//远程搜索的方法 该方法好处:编辑回显时,如果当前下拉值在下拉数据中没有,也会显示到下拉列表的...